Romanesco broccoli is a glabrous, erect, annual or biennial herb that may grow about 80-130 cm tall. There are two main types of broccoli. That is, broccoli … Romanesco broccoli (also known as Roman cauliflower, Broccolo Romanesco, Romanesque cauliflower, or simply Romanesco) is an edible flower bud of the species Brassica oleracea.First documented in Italy in the 16th century, it is chartreuse in color, and has a form naturally approximating a fractal.When compared to a traditional cauliflower, it has a firmer texture and delicate, nutty flavor. If growing romanesco in cooler zones, sow the seeds 4 – 6 weeks prior to planting outside. Plant it in early spring or late summer for a fall and winter crop. If growing in subtropical and tropical zones you can plant it in fall or in winter. Broccoli grows best where air temperatures range between 45° and 75°F (7.2-24°C). Broccoli is a cool weather plant, preferring soil temperatures between 65 and 80 degrees Fahrenheit (18 and 27 degrees Fahrenheit).
